A soil examination will determine the level of soil acidity, which is made use of to create a recommended quantity of lime for your lawn. Lime is ideal applied in the fall and very early winter, and when done appropriately will not need to be applied each year. See Rutgers Cooperative Extension (RCE) publication Dirt Examining for Home Lawns and Gardens (FS797), and for more details about obtaining your soil tested.

Color and development price of the turf offer as a guide in establishing the need for nitrogen fertilizer. Sluggish growth and light-green color need to be expected at different times of the year for grass with a low-maintenance purpose. Extreme thinning of the lawn and exposure of soil is a likely signs and symptom of nutrient deficiency under a low-maintenance program.




Many fertilizer products are readily available and are composed of 2 fundamental forms of N: water soluble and water insoluble. Water insoluble nitrogen (SUCCESS) is likewise understood as slowly available or slow-moving launch and is usually the best and extra practical kind to utilize for a lot of homeowner, albeit more pricey.




Select a plant food quality (N-P2O5-K2O) based on the outcomes of a dirt test. See Feeding the Home Grass (FS633) to learn more. Addition of natural issue to improve dirt is best done prior to establishing a grass considering that it is a very tough and slow process to include organic materials right into soil after lawn has covered the dirt.


Constant mowing at 2 inches or reduced tends to deteriorate the turf and rise pest and various other Full Article tension troubles (Lawn Care). Frequency of mowing is finest determined by the rate of growth of the grass. As an overview, cut as regularly as necessary to remove no even more than of the leaf height in a single mowing

A plain blade shreds the grass leaves, deteriorates the lawn, and turns the leaf ideas brownish, giving an unattractive appearance to the yard. Dull lawn mower blades might additionally boost the extent of foliar turfgrass conditions. Trimming need to quit in the loss when lawn growth has basically discontinued as a result of winter.


Recuperation from this problem needs water and time for new leaves to be re-formed and recover grass cover. Irrigation ought to moisten the dirt to a deepness of visit their website 6 inches, which must suffice water for regarding 1 week on "heavier" finer-textured soils and 2 to 3 days on sandy soilsapplying much less water than this will certainly cause the demand for more frequent watering.




Late evening with morning is the most reliable and reliable time period for watering. See Best Monitoring Practices for Watering Lawns (FS555) for additional information. Dethatching vigorous thick lawns that have actually collected a thick layer of natural material (thatch, being composed mostly of roots and rhizomes) on the dirt surface and listed below the eco-friendly leaves can boost the tension tolerance of the grass.


When the lawn has even more than a -inch deep thatch layer, it would gain from dethatching in the fall. Mechanical gadgets (dethatching devices) are readily available for purchase or leasing. These machines ought to have a vertical blade strictly fixed on a rotating shaft and the capability to adjust the blade to penetrate entirely through the thatch layer and right into the dirt.
